MASSILLON -- Ohio State Highway Patrol are looking for help finding a suspect from a fatal hit and run accident Sunday evening in Massillon.
A green and tan mini van heading south on Erie Street made a wide right turn onto S.R. 241, hitting Michael D. Braatz, 70, of Wooster, who was on a motorcycle. The van continued westbound on S.R. 241, said highway patrol.
The accident was reported at about 6:42 p.m. The driver of the van was reportedly driving erratically.
Braatz was taken to Affinity Hospital where he later died. He was wearing a helmet at the time of the crash.
Witnesses say the van is a late 80s to early 90s two-tone Chevy or Plymouth minivan that is green on the top and tan on the bottom.
Two people were seen inside the van. The driver was described only as a middle aged white man.
Anyone with information to aid the ongoing investigation should call the Canton Patrol Post at (330) 433-6200.
